The internet has not been kind to spirulina’s reputation for accuracy. For every legitimate clinical finding, there are ten exaggerated claims – overnight transformations, complete immune system overhauls, total body cleanses in 72 hours. The noise makes it genuinely difficult to understand what spirulina can and cannot do.

This article cuts through it. Three categories – immunity, energy, and detox – examined plainly, with the evidence that holds up and the claims that do not.

IMMUNITY

Claim: “Spirulina supercharges your immune system instantly.”

Verdict: Partly true – but the timeline and mechanism are specific.

Spirulina does support immune function. That is not in dispute. What is in dispute is the word “instantly” and the vague notion of “supercharging” – which implies a kind of dramatic, immediate transformation that no food or supplement produces.

Here is what the research actually shows. Spirulina stimulates the activity of natural killer cells – a class of immune cells that identify and destroy infected or abnormal cells. It activates macrophages, the immune system’s frontline responders. It increases production of immunoglobulins – the antibody proteins your body uses to tag pathogens for destruction. These are real, documented effects, observed in controlled human trials.

The timeline matters. Most studies demonstrating immune outcomes run four to twelve weeks of consistent supplementation. Spirulina is not an acute intervention – it is a nutritional input that gradually shifts baseline immune competence. One dose before a long-haul flight does not do what three months of 4.5 grams daily does.

What actually drives this: Spirulina’s immune support comes from several directions simultaneously. Phycocyanin at 10-20% of dry weight reduces the oxidative stress that impairs immune cell function. Vitamins C, E, and B6 each support specific immune pathways. Selenium and zinc – both present in spirulina’s mineral profile – activate enzymes critical to immune response. This is not a single-compound effect. It is a broad nutritional input that supports immunity through multiple mechanisms at once.

The myth to reject: That spirulina prevents infection or replaces medical intervention. It does not. It provides nutritional scaffolding that supports a well-functioning immune system. That is meaningful – and it is also enough. It does not need to be more than that to be worth taking.

 

ENERGY

Claim: “Spirulina gives you an instant energy boost like caffeine.”

Verdict: False – but the real energy benefit is more durable and worth understanding.

Spirulina contains no caffeine. It has no stimulant mechanism. It does not act on the central nervous system in the way that coffee, tea, or energy drinks do. Anyone claiming that spirulina produces an immediate, perceptible energy surge within minutes of consumption is describing a placebo effect, not a physiological one.

What spirulina does – and this is genuinely useful – is address the nutritional deficiencies that cause energy to drop in the first place.

Iron deficiency is one of the most common causes of persistent fatigue globally, affecting over 1.2 billion people. At approximately 410 mg of iron per kilogram, spirulina is one of the most iron-dense plant-based sources available. Correcting iron deficiency through consistent dietary intake – including spirulina as a contributing source – produces real, measurable improvements in energy levels, concentration, and physical endurance. But this happens over weeks, not minutes.

B vitamins – B1, B2, B3, B6, and B12 are all present in spirulina – are directly involved in cellular energy metabolism. They are cofactors in the enzymatic processes that convert food into ATP, the molecule your cells use as fuel. Deficiency in any of these vitamins impairs energy production at the cellular level. Spirulina’s B-vitamin content supports that machinery.

What actually drives this: The energy benefit of spirulina is corrective, not stimulant-based. It works by supplying the micronutrients that energy metabolism depends on – iron, B vitamins, magnesium – in a bioavailable form. For people whose fatigue has a nutritional root cause, the improvement is real. For people who are nutritionally replete but simply tired, spirulina is not a substitute for sleep.

The myth to reject: That spirulina is a natural energy drink. It is not. It is a nutritional supplement that addresses deficiency-related fatigue over consistent use. That distinction matters – because it sets accurate expectations, and accurate expectations are the only ones worth having.

 

DETOX

Claim: “Spirulina detoxes your body and flushes out toxins.”

Verdict: Partially supported – but the mechanism is specific, not the vague “flush” that wellness marketing implies.

The word “detox” has been so thoroughly abused in wellness marketing that it has almost lost meaning. The human body detoxifies continuously – the liver, kidneys, and lymphatic system handle this around the clock without assistance from a green powder. Any product claiming to “detox” in a general, non-specific sense is not describing a biological process.

Where spirulina does have documented, specific detoxification-related activity is in heavy metal binding and elimination – and this is a legitimate and clinically studied area, not a marketing claim.

Chlorophyll-a, present at a minimum of 1% by dry weight in quality spirulina, has demonstrated ability to bind to heavy metals and certain carcinogens in the digestive tract, reducing their absorption before they enter systemic circulation. This is a specific mechanism – binding in the gut – not a systemic “cleanse.”

More significantly, spirulina has been examined as a nutritional intervention in populations with documented heavy metal exposure. Studies in arsenic-affected communities showed measurable reductions in blood and urine arsenic levels following controlled spirulina supplementation. A study in Bangladesh involving patients with chronic arsenic poisoning found that spirulina extract combined with zinc produced a 47% reduction in arsenic concentration in hair samples – a hard outcome, not a soft wellness claim.

Phycocyanin’s antioxidant activity is also relevant here. Heavy metal toxicity causes oxidative stress – phycocyanin’s ability to neutralise reactive oxygen species provides some cellular protection even where direct binding is not the primary mechanism.

What actually drives this: Chlorophyll binding in the gut, phycocyanin-mediated antioxidant protection, and – in the context of heavy metal exposure specifically – a documented reduction in circulating metal levels. These are real effects. They apply to specific populations and specific exposures, not to the vague notion of “flushing toxins” from a clean, healthy body.

The myth to reject: That spirulina performs a general body cleanse. It does not. What it does – binding specific compounds in the gut, reducing oxidative damage from environmental exposures – is more targeted, more modest, and more real than the wellness industry’s version of detox. Real is better than dramatic.

 

What Quality Has to Do With All of This

Every mechanism described above – the immune activation, the iron delivery, the chlorophyll binding, the phycocyanin antioxidant activity – depends on those compounds being present in the spirulina at meaningful concentrations.

Phycocyanin at 18% of dry weight produces anti-inflammatory and antioxidant effects. The same compound at 2-3% – degraded by spray drying at 150°C or sun drying over 48 hours – does not produce the same outcomes. Iron at 410 mg per kilogram addresses deficiency. Iron that has leached from the product due to improper storage or packaging does not.

The gap between spirulina that delivers and spirulina that merely claims is infrastructure. Controlled cultivation at 30-37°C. Automated harvesting through 500-mesh rotary drum systems. Refractive Window Drying below 45°C. In-house laboratory testing per batch against a full COA panel. This is the production standard that the research literature is built on – and it is not the standard every product on the market meets.
